Getting Started with Akita Chow Training

The first step in training an Akita Chow is to establish yourself as the pack leader. Akita Chows are intelligent dogs, and they need to know that you are in charge. This can be done by setting clear boundaries and enforcing them consistently.

The next step is to start teaching your Akita Chow basic commands. This can be done through positive reinforcement, such as giving treats or praise when they obey a command. It is important to be consistent and patient when teaching commands, as it can take some time for an Akita Chow to learn them.

Once your Akita Chow has mastered the basics, you can start teaching them more advanced commands. This can include things like agility training, tricks, and other activities that will help them stay mentally and physically stimulated.

Common Challenges in Akita Chow Training

One of the most common challenges in Akita Chow training is their stubbornness. Akita Chows can be very strong-willed and may not always obey commands. To combat this, it is important to be consistent and patient when training them, and to provide them with plenty of rewards and encouragement.

Another common challenge is their tendency to become bored easily. Akita Chows need a lot of mental stimulation, so it is important to keep their training sessions interesting and engaging. This can be done by varying their activities and introducing new commands and tricks regularly.
